> I was wanting to write GTK program which allowed Cyrillic input.
> I asked Owen to give me some clues, but I have done something wrong
> and/or the suggestions did not work. Perhaps there is someone on the
> list who has done something like this which can help me?
>
> I have looked through a couple Russification web pages, and nothing
> seems to work for me.
What he wrote to you is right. You have to have a Russian locale. It
may very well be that the locale you have is old. Get a newer version
of the C library. If it does not work, drop me a line, I'll try to
find you a good locale. I do not have it with me now because I am working
on Sparc, and Sun "thinks" we should russify computers with iso8859-5
(at least in Solaris 2.5.1) which is stupid -- almost none uses iso8859-5
these days.
